22.01.2022 With the sun making the odd appearance and some outdoor social gathering allowed under current directions you might be thinking that now is the time for a picni...c. You are right, but only if you are doing your picnic right. As we move toward COVID Normal it is more important than ever that we do what we can to prevent community transmission. That means: Instagram-worthy platters will have to wait - shared cutlery and food are a transmission risk. Keep yourself safe from your double dipping friend and choose single serve options. Masks are a must and while you can remove them to eat, they must be replaced afterwards. No hugs, handshakes or cheek kisses maintain your physical distance. Your outdoor gathering should go for less than 2 hours and be with either your own household OR one person for another household if you are in Metropolitan Melbourne. 05.01.2022 We're all in it together and together it's a whole lot easier if we remove fear, anger and panic by practicing gratitude. Of a morning: List 10 things - these a...re the big things in your life you are grateful for and they might not change day to day. Yet they act as a reminder as to why we are so bloody lucky to live in this country. *** (If you're reading this, you have internet and social media and ways to connect so theres 3 to get you started.) Of an evening: List as many things as possible within the last 24 hours that you appreciate or are grateful for that have happened to you. These can range from the door being held open for you, for the ability to work from home in these tough times, to having food in the cupboard. Enjoy the little things right now, lean in to them. For it's times like these that they are truly the biggest and best things. Be gentle, remain kind, stay grateful. Stronger together
